HDFC Bank PDFs are often password-protected — use your Customer ID or date of birth (DDMMYYYY) to unlock before uploading. Bank statement PDFs are unstructured — there's no standard API. Extracting clean, typed transaction data from PDFs requires significant engineering effort.

How do I use HDFC Bank statements for developers?
Log in to HDFC NetBanking → Accounts → Bank Statement → Select date range → Download as PDF. Then upload to MintConvert and download a clean JSON file.
